About The Role

The Analyst, Workday HRIS role is responsible for configuration, system maintenance, and tenant management across the Workday platform. This position will initially focus on supporting our Workday implementation to success, then transition to continuous support and optimization of Workday. The role combines technical expertise with analytical problem‑solving skills to ensure system integrity, data accuracy, and optimal functionality through effective collaboration with stakeholders.

The Ideal Candidate Will Have
  • A commitment to continuous improvement and focus on delivering best in class user experiences in the moments that matter
  • Strong analytical and troubleshooting skills with meticulous attention to detail
  • Proven ability to manage system configurations and changes while maintaining data integrity and system security
  • Experience with change control processes and ability to balance multiple priorities in a fast‑paced environment
  • Excellent communication skills to translate technical concepts to non‑technical audiences
What You’ll Do
  • Serve as point of contact for assigned modules, managing system maintenance, configuration, and user access while ensuring the protection of sensitive HR data
  • Troubleshoot, research, and resolve system defects and issues, working collaboratively with stakeholders to identify root causes and implement solutions while proactively keeping end‑users aware of status
  • Ensure data integrity, confidentiality, security, process efficiency, and accessibility through effective systems implementation, configuration, administration, and user training
  • Support and promote adoption of global best practices and standards
  • Configure and maintain Workday business processes across multiple modules to support HR operations and business requirements
  • Assess, configure, and migrate system changes through development, test, and production environments
  • Maintain overall system hygiene and health through regular audits and proactive monitoring
  • Coordinate and execute bi‑annual Workday system releases, including testing new features, documenting changes, and communicating impacts to stakeholders
  • Manage change control and release management processes to ensure smooth deployment of system updates and enhancements
  • Ensure security best practices are followed and access is appropriately granted based on business needs
  • Create and update reports using Workday reporting tools to provide insights and support business decision‑making
  • Partner with cross‑functional teams including HR leadership, HRIS, HR Centers of Excellence (CoEs), and local market HR teams to support system initiatives and business process initiatives
  • Participate in the development and execution of the strategic roadmap for our Workday ecosystem
  • Complete continuing education to maintain domain and product knowledge

Preferred Qualifications
  • Workday certification(s) in one or more modules (Core HCM, Absence, Performance, etc.)
  • Bachelor’s degree in related field (Information Systems, HR, Business Administration, or similar)
  • Hands‑on experience with Workday business process configuration, security administration, and integration tools
  • Proficiency with Workday reporting tools including Report Writer, Calculated Fields, and dashboards
  • Knowledge of the Workday Security framework including security groups, roles, and domain security configuration
  • Experience with Enterprise Interface Builders (EIBs) and data management
  • Knowledge of integration platforms and API concepts
